On the evening of June 15th, Wang Hua, the General Manager of the Public Relations Department of Xiaomi Group, wrote that he saw news about a certain university banning the use of Redmi phones for online exams. After communicating with the university and the relevant app company, it was clarified that the decision to ban Redmi phones from exams was not made by the university, but by the company providing online exam technical support. Wang Hua stated, "This is actually a misconception that has not been updated. Redmi phones are no longer the low-cost devices they used to be. Nowadays, the Redmi brand has been upgraded, with models like Note, Turbo, and K series known for their quality and performance. Especially the K series is now a flagship model with luxury performance, fully capable of meeting all online exam requirements."
